    Default Porclain Floor tiles cracking on corner cuts

    I've recently had my kitchen floor tiled with 60x60 polished porclain floor tiles. After two weeks 2 tiles have cracked these are tiles that have been cut round external corners. Is this due to the way the tiles have been cut? the tiles are fixed to a solid concrete floor.
    Also there seems to be a few tiles that when tapped sound hollow in places will this affect the tiles in the long term?

    Can you provide any photo's please, and also do you know what adhesive and grout was used. If there is a hollow sound from some of the tiles, it sounds as though they have been dot and dabbed. The correct method would be a solid bed of adhesive. Do you have underfloor heating?

    Yes... Cracking tiles is never good. Could you give a bit more info on the floor? How long was the concrete down for before being tiled? Do you know what adhesives the tiler used? Any under floor heting?

    It sounds like the tiler has built the tiles up on adhesive and left voids under them, the tiles have then cracked at their weakest point. If the tiler has used 5 spot, Im afraid you can prob expect more broken tiles.

    Hollow sound could be dot and dab but could also be delamination. If they have cracked at external or re-entrant corners this suggests restraint at the corner which suggests either thermal movement or shrinkage. I would lay odds that if you lift one of the cracked tiles you will find a crack in the substrate.
